Village
Bocking is a suburban village on the northern side of , in , England. Bocking village was historically in two parts; the original settlement around the parish church became known as , while a separate linear settlement called Bocking grew up a little way to the south along Bradford Street and The Causeway, adjoining the northern edge of Braintree.
